Destinyhoodie, 8/8/2024 2:03:02 PM
It was such a fun day. We were the first ones picked up and the trip started around 3:30 am and we didn't get back until about 11pm (it was a long day). Luckily, the van was fairly comfortable and we ended up sleeping a lot during the drive. The road through the mountains is very windy so make sure you take some dramamine if you have motion sickness issues. David the driver was really great. he didn't speak english, but we really didn't expect him to. He still tried to help us out the best he could. all three locations were really great. We didn't end up swimming at Misol Ha because we were only there for about 45 minutes, so it would've been nice to spend a little more time there. Palenque was the final stop and we spent about 2 hours there. Plenty if you don't do a guided tour (optional) but we did an english guided tour and we felt a bit rushed towards the end. On a side note, the English-speaking guide, Carlos, was really great and knowledgeable. Showed us the ruins buried in the jungle and we even saw Howler monkeys! If you do this, make sure you take some snacks. Apart from a stop at a cafe for breakfast, we really didn't make another meal stop. But, tbf, the bus voted on whether or not we would stop to eat. I'm glad we didn't stop before palenque since we were already a little rushed as is. the bus voted to stop at a gas station with a few food vendors out front for our final stop and then the last leg of our trip was a non-stop 5.5 hour drive back to San Cristobal. Just a heads up, there is a hotel in Palenque and you can choose to stay there and find another way back if you don't want to have such a long day. there was one couple on our bus that did that, and honestly, I kinda wished we did too. Overall, for the price especially, we would recommend. Everyone was really nice and helpful.

noelleo489, 4/22/2023 11:29:11 AM
I did this very long day trip as a one-way, staying in Palenque instead of going back to San Cristobal. I booked with Jalapeño who are cheaper than some other agents. I had booked a different day tour through my hotel and paid more and it was still Otisa travel (which is Jalapeño’s other name) who operated the tour so I think it is better to go to them directly. Everything ran smoothly and on time. Our driver did a good job of staying ahead of the herd of tour buses so we got shady parking and quieter times for photos. Contrary to what Lonely planet says, you should swim in Agua Azul (not Misol-Ha), which has lots of lovely swimming spots as well and plenty food vendors and shops and we had 2 hours here. Misol Ha was a shorter stop for photos. In Palenque, our bus hired a guide. Palenque is a beautiful site. Although it was a long day it was worth the effort. We did not eat until after Palenque - tell your driver if you want to eat beforehand. I think there was a communication breakdown as we would have preferred to eat before. I am glad I did not have to drive back.
Michael_W, 1/9/2023 1:16:29 PM
The 5 hours we spent at Palenque, Misol-ha and Agua Azul were absolutely incredible. The natural beauty and history is stunning. It was well worth paying extra for a guided tour of Palenque (only your entrance is included in this tour). These are 3 sights you have to see. However we spent 13 hours on a bus on a windy, bumpy road through the jungle. It was intense to say the least and we absolutely hated the travel, despite our driver’s best efforts. Some people were smart and travelled one way with an overnight stay in Palenque to break up their journey. I really wish we had done this because the bus journey was interminable. We left San Cristobal at 3.30am and only returned home around 9.30pm.
